What Is The Loved Ones About? (No Spoilers)

In the quiet suburbs of an ordinary high‑school town, the promise of prom looms like a glittering rite of passage, but beneath the polished veneer a darker undercurrent stirs. When the invitation to the night of celebration is turned down, Lola Stone—a charismatic yet unmistakably unstable senior—sets in motion a plan that will turn the evening into something far more unsettling. With the help of her equally dangerous father, Eric Stone, she decides that the boy who rejected her, Brent Mitchell, must become part of a twisted homage to the “princess” she envisions.

Brent, a typical teenager haunted by his own recent loss, finds his world abruptly shifted from the familiar corridors of school life to a night that feels both surreal and menacing. As the date approaches, he is coaxed into a night that promises a simple façade—a fake escort for the school’s most coveted role—yet the reality is an unsettling blend of performance and manipulation that blurs the line between affection and control. The stakes feel intimate, the setting confined, and the atmosphere thick with an uneasy mix of teenage yearning and foreboding dread.

The film’s tone balances stark horror with mordant humor, turning the familiar rituals of adolescence into a playground for obsession. Lola’s relentless determination and Eric’s unsettling support create a dynamic that feels both intimate and terrifying, hinting at a family bond warped by possessiveness. Meanwhile, Brent must navigate his own grief and the pressure of expectations, his relationships with his mother Carla and his girlfriend Holly adding layers of emotional complexity that make the looming confrontation feel inevitable yet unpredictable.

Against a backdrop of suburban normalcy turned nightmarish, the story invites viewers to wonder how far a single rejection can spiral when love turns into a weapon. The mood is saturated with a chilling, off‑kilter charm that keeps the audience perched on the edge of discomfort, eager to see how the night’s twisted choreography will unfold.
